A Closer Look at the Electrical Panel Upgrade?

An electrical panel upgrade involves swapping out an old electrical panel — sometimes referred to as a breaker box or load center — with a current-generation system built for today's electrical demands. The panel sits at the center of every wiring branch in your residence, distributing current to lighting, HVAC, and plug-in devices. When the existing unit can't handle the load, hazards develop.

Homes constructed several decades ago were wired with panels designed to handle 60 to 100 amperes, which felt like plenty back then. Modern households commonly need 150 to 200 amps or beyond that, especially with EV charging stations, central air conditioning, and whole-home generators. What happens during the job involves carefully de-energizing the service entrance, mounting the new panel, migrating circuits to new breakers, and restoring power safely.

Today's upgraded units come equipped with arc-fault circuit interrupters (AFCIs) and ground-fault circuit interrupters (GFCIs), meeting current code standards. This isn't cosmetic — those protections directly lower the likelihood of wiring-related fires in your residence.

What You Gain from an Electrical Panel Upgrade

  • Greater Electrical Capacity — A new higher-rated panel supports additional circuits and future demand without tripping breakers.
  • Improved Home Safety — Aging load centers have a history of unsafe operation, making replacement a priority.
  • Meeting Current Electrical Code — A panel upgrade brings your home's electrical system into alignment with current NEC standards, a requirement for many home improvement projects and sales.
  • EV Charger Compatibility — Adding an electric vehicle charger demands significant amperage that older 60-amp services cannot handle.
  • Lower Homeowner's Insurance Costs — Many insurance carriers discount premiums when a new code-compliant panel is installed.
  • Higher Home Resale Value — Home buyers and their lenders commonly require panel upgrades, so upgrading before listing smooths the transaction.
  • Reliable, Consistent Power — Tripped breakers, dimming lights, and warm outlet covers signal that your current service isn't keeping up.
  • Room for Home Additions — Planning a finished basement, a home office, or a workshop goes smoothly with a properly sized panel already in place.

Step-by-Step: What an Electrical Panel Upgrade Looks Like

  1. Home Electrical Evaluation

    Our technician visits your home to evaluate your current panel. We document the panel's age, brand, amperage rating, and condition. This step determines what size and type of panel you need.

  2. Handling Permits and the Utility Company

    Our team files all required local permits with the city or municipality before we schedule the job. We also schedule with the power company to arrange a temporary service disconnect for the project.

  3. Safe De-Energization and Panel Removal

    With the meter pulled and power confirmed off, our electrician carefully labels every circuit before removing the old breakers and panel enclosure. Proper labeling at this stage prevents errors during reinstallation.

  4. Installing the Upgraded Panel Enclosure

    The new panel enclosure is mounted, grounded, and bonded following current code requirements. Every wire is reattached to the correct breaker position in the new panel, with a completed, legible circuit directory.

  5. Passing the Electrical Inspection

    The local inspection authority walks through the upgrade to ensure the installation is safe and correct. After the inspector signs off, ComEd reconnects the service and power is restored to your home.

  6. Load Testing and Homeowner Education

    Each branch circuit is tested to ensure correct voltage and continuity. The homeowner gets a full orientation — identifying every circuit on the new directory and how to reset a tripped AFCI or GFCI breaker.

Who Benefits Most from an Electrical Panel Upgrade?

Homeowners who benefit most for an electrical panel upgrade typically have specific warning signs: a panel that runs warm or shows signs of scorching; homes where the electrical system hasn't been touched in check here 20 or more years; situations where the panel is nearly full and no open slots remain. Even a single flag on that list is worth investigating with a licensed electrician.

Homes built before 1990 stand out as strong candidates because residential electrical demand has changed dramatically over the decades. It's also worth noting that a newer home can still need an upgrade — a home where the original panel was undersized for the build may need a service upgrade just as urgently.

Situations where a panel upgrade may not be the only answer include cases where an electrician determines the root cause is upstream at the utility transformer rather than the panel itself. We provide a clear-eyed diagnosis so you aren't paying for work that won't solve the problem.

Common Questions on Electrical Panel Upgrade

How much time should I set aside for an electrical panel upgrade?

The typical upgrade job is completed in a single day assuming no unexpected conditions inside the walls. Larger service upgrades — such as moving from 100 to 200 amps with new meter base work — may run a full day. Plan for a full-day outage during the installation.

What does an electrical panel upgrade cost in Palos Hills?

The cost of an electrical panel upgrade varies based on a few key variables: your current amperage, the target amperage, whether the meter base needs replacement, and local permit fees. For most homes in this area, homeowners should budget between $2,000 and $4,500 for a full 200-amp upgrade. A firm quote requires a look at your specific home.

Is an electrical panel upgrade disruptive to my home?

Our crew works primarily in the utility area where your panel is mounted, and the rest of the home is generally unaffected. The main inconvenience is the power outage for the duration of the work. We schedule jobs to minimize the impact on your routine.

Do I need a permit for an electrical panel upgrade?

A permit is required without exception for this type of work in Palos Hills and surrounding communities. Permitting ensures the work is inspected by a neutral third party, not as a formality. Reed Electrical Services, LLC. handles all permit filings so the administrative side is handled for you.

What's the difference between a panel repair and an electrical panel upgrade?

A single tripped or failed breaker can often be replaced without upgrading the entire panel. However, if your panel is undersized, overheating, made by a flagged manufacturer like Federal Pacific or Zinsco, or simply full with no open slots, a full electrical panel upgrade is the right call. The on-site assessment our team performs will clearly identify which situation applies to your home.
